| Notes for Aethelred II, King of England |
| "Reigned 979-1013 (deposed) and 1014-1016. In the face of Danish raids, he was forced to pay huge tributes (Danegeld) to the enemy. He was driven into exile by Sweyn but returned after [Sweyn's] death. Died during Canute's invasion of England. His tomb was lost when the old St. Paul's was destroyed in the great fire of London."149 |
